"Karimoku x Blue Bottle Coffee Morning Collection", a collaboration product of Blue Bottle Coffee and Karimoku furniture, will be released. From December 1st, "Dripper Stand", "Filter Case" and "Cutting Board" will be available.

Karimoku Furniture was founded in 1940 at a woodworking factory in Kariya City, Aichi Prefecture. A manufacturer that started selling its own wooden furniture in the 1960s, it also produces furniture for some cafes of Blue Bottle Coffee. This time, we are designing three types of goods that can be placed in the interior of a room or kitchen so that you can look forward to waking up in the morning and brewing coffee. Both have a collaboration logo on the bottom.

The "Dripper Stand" has a simple and soft design that adds color to the interior. The original blue bottle dripper and carafe fit snugly and are designed to allow the coffee to fall cleanly when dripping. You can use it by placing a scale under the stand so that you can drip with a more accurate amount of hot water. The selling price is 10,450 yen.

The "filter case" was developed to match the original coffee filter from Blue Bottle. Designed to fit a 30-sheet filter. There is a slit on the side, making it easy to take out while keeping the original shape of the filter. The lid can also be used as a coaster. The selling price is 7,700 yen.
